## Further Reading

The Ledgewick tax-rate lookup cache warrants careful study before any on-call shift. Entries expire hourly, but jurisdiction changes from the Ratefall feed can force early invalidation, and stale reads during that window are the most common incident cause. Understand the fallback ordering before touching anything. The full architecture notes, invalidation semantics, and incident history are maintained on the internal page below.

wiki page, tahaf-tajog: https://jira.ordindyn.corp/pipeline

Ticket: Staging env misconfigured for Siftgate bloom filter

The bloom layer in front of the Pellet KV store is rejecting all lookups in staging because the env file was copied from the dev template without credentials. False-positive tuning values are fine; only the auth line is missing. To unblock the weekly demo, the Pellet admission secret must be set on the following line.

env line for yaguf-fajop: LEDGER_TOKEN13=fb08984397349

## Further Reading

So, per-tenant rate quotas. The short version: Quotamancer assigns each tenant a token bucket, and the Skylark gateway enforces it at the edge. Overrides live in the tenant config, not in code — please don't hardcode limits like we did in 2022. For the full design rationale, burst math, and escalation process, see the internal page below.

operations page: https://vault.qorvelcorp.example/settings